Home
last modified time | relevance | path

Searched refs:InlineParams (Results 1 – 13 of 13)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DInlineOrder.cpp47 const InlineParams &Params) { in getInlineCostWrapper()
78 const InlineParams &) { in SizePriority() argument
95 const InlineParams &Params) { in CostPriority()
115 const InlineParams &Params) { in CostBenefitPriority()
186 const InlineParams &Params) { in MLPriority()
237 PriorityInlineOrder(FunctionAnalysisManager &FAM, const InlineParams &Params) in PriorityInlineOrder()
280 const InlineParams &Params;
289 const InlineParams &Params, in getDefaultInlineOrder()
313 llvm::getInlineOrder(FunctionAnalysisManager &FAM, const InlineParams &Params, in getInlineOrder()
H A DInlineCost.cpp610 const InlineParams &Params;
1203 Function &Callee, CallBase &Call, const InlineParams &Params, in InlineCostCallAnalyzer()
1319 InlineParams IndirectCallParams = {/* DefaultThreshold*/ 0, in onLoweredCall()
3131 CallBase &Call, const InlineParams &Params, TargetTransformInfo &CalleeTTI, in getInlineCost()
3148 const InlineParams Params = {/* DefaultThreshold*/ 0, in getInliningCostEstimate()
3258 CallBase &Call, Function *Callee, const InlineParams &Params, in getInlineCost()
3367 InlineParams llvm::getInlineParams(int Threshold) { in getInlineParams()
3368 InlineParams Params; in getInlineParams()
3420 InlineParams llvm::getInlineParams() { in getInlineParams()
3437 InlineParams llvm::getInlineParams(unsigned OptLevel, unsigned SizeOptLevel) { in getInlineParams()
[all …]
H A DInlineAdvisor.cpp145 CallBase &CB, FunctionAnalysisManager &FAM, const InlineParams &Params) { in getDefaultInlineAdvice()
232 InlineParams Params, InliningAdvisorMode Mode, in tryCreate()
/freebsd/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DInlineCost.h207 struct InlineParams { struct
248 LLVM_ABI InlineParams getInlineParams(); argument
253 LLVM_ABI InlineParams getInlineParams(int Threshold);
261 LLVM_ABI InlineParams getInlineParams(unsigned OptLevel, unsigned SizeOptLevel);
280 CallBase &Call, const InlineParams &Params, TargetTransformInfo &CalleeTTI,
294 CallBase &Call, Function *Callee, const InlineParams &Params,
H A DInlineOrder.h36 getDefaultInlineOrder(FunctionAnalysisManager &FAM, const InlineParams &Params,
40 getInlineOrder(FunctionAnalysisManager &FAM, const InlineParams &Params,
59 const InlineParams &Params,
H A DInlineAdvisor.h234 InlineParams Params, InlineContext IC) in DefaultInlineAdvisor()
240 InlineParams Params;
288 InlineParams Params,
322 LLVM_ABI bool tryCreate(InlineParams Params, InliningAdvisorMode Mode,
/freebsd/contrib/llvm-project/llvm/include/llvm/Transforms/IPO/
H A DModuleInliner.h30 ModuleInlinerPass(InlineParams Params = getInlineParams(),
42 const InlineParams Params;
H A DInliner.h68 InlineParams Params = getInlineParams(), bool MandatoryFirst = true,
95 const InlineParams Params;
/freebsd/contrib/llvm-project/llvm/lib/Passes/
H A DPassBuilderPipelines.cpp797 InlineParams IP; in addPreInlinerPasses()
912 static InlineParams getInlineParamsFromOptLevel(OptimizationLevel Level) { in getInlineParamsFromOptLevel()
919 InlineParams IP; in buildInlinerPipeline()
1020 InlineParams IP = getInlineParamsFromOptLevel(Level); in buildModuleInlinerPipeline()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DInliner.cpp582 ModuleInlinerWrapperPass::ModuleInlinerWrapperPass(InlineParams Params, in ModuleInlinerWrapperPass()
H A DSampleProfile.cpp1360 InlineParams Params = getInlineParams(); in shouldInlineCandidate()
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DDeclSpec.cpp239 NumParams <= std::size(TheDeclarator.InlineParams)) { in getFunction()
240 I.Fun.Params = TheDeclarator.InlineParams; in getFunction()
/freebsd/contrib/llvm-project/clang/include/clang/Sema/
H A DDeclSpec.h1990 DeclaratorChunk::ParamInfo InlineParams[16]; member